Eisai's E2086 Receives Orphan Drug Designation in Japan for Narcolepsy Treatment

Eisai Co., Ltd. announced today that its novel selective orexin 2 receptor (搜索) agonist E2086 has received orphan drug designation from Japan's Ministry of Health, Labour and Welfare (MHLW) for the treatment of narcolepsy (搜索). The designation represents a significant regulatory milestone for the in-house discovered compound, which targets a chronic sleep disorder affecting an estimated 46,000 patients in Japan.
Novel Mechanism Addresses Narcolepsy Pathophysiology
E2086 represents a unique therapeutic approach to narcolepsy (搜索) treatment by selectively activating orexin (搜索) 2 receptors. The compound works by enhancing orexin receptor activity and acting on the underlying pathophysiology of narcolepsy, particularly in type 1 narcolepsy where autoimmune destruction of orexin-producing neurons in the hypothalamus leads to orexin deficiency.
Orexin (搜索) serves as a critical neurotransmitter in regulating sleep and wakefulness. While activating orexinergic neurons helps maintain stable wakefulness, inhibiting these neurons promotes natural sleep transitions. Eisai leveraged its established orexin platform, previously used to develop the insomnia treatment DAYVIGO (lemborexant), to create E2086 as an agonist rather than antagonist.
Clinical Evidence Demonstrates Efficacy
Nonclinical studies of E2086 showed statistically significant increases in time spent awake and significant reductions in cataplexy rates. More importantly, Phase Ib clinical trial data presented at the World Sleep 2025 congress demonstrated that E2086 achieved a statistically significant reduction in excessive daytime sleepiness compared to both placebo and the existing standard treatment modafinil in patients with narcolepsy (搜索) type 1.
The clinical results suggest E2086 has the potential to improve daytime wakefulness in narcolepsy (搜索) patients, addressing one of the most debilitating symptoms of the condition.
Addressing High Unmet Medical Need
Narcolepsy (搜索) remains a disease with high unmet medical needs due to problems with fatigue, cognition, and persistence of residual symptoms despite current treatment options. The condition is classified into two subtypes: type 1 (narcolepsy with cataplexy) and type 2 (narcolepsy without cataplexy). While type 1's pathogenesis involves orexin (搜索) deficiency from autoimmune destruction of hypothalamic neurons, type 2's mechanism remains unknown, though reduced orexin neurotransmission may also play a role.
Patient population estimates in Japan vary depending on study methodology. According to a study using the JMDC Inc. insurance database, approximately 23,000 narcolepsy (搜索) patients were identified based on medical claims over two consecutive months, while the number increases to 46,000 when including patients with two or more medical claims over a 12-month period.
Orphan Drug Benefits Support Development
The orphan drug designation provides E2086 with several development advantages under Japan's support system for rare diseases. The designation requires that fewer than 50,000 people in Japan are expected to use the drug, that no suitable alternatives exist or the proposed drug offers significant advantages over existing treatments, and that scientific rationale supports the drug's necessity.
Benefits include prioritized consultation for clinical development, priority examination processes, reduced application fees, extended re-examination periods, research and development subsidies, and tax incentives. These measures aim to accelerate development of treatments for diseases with small patient populations where research and development has not progressed despite high medical need.
